Along the route through mountain meadows and forested slopes, keep your eyes open for remains of the Black Hills mining, logging and railroading heyday: old buildings and retaining walls, mine adits, telegraph poles and original concrete railroad markers. Important: Water is turned off at trailheads during winter; however, bring ample water even in summer because towns are far between.
